What the filing says
Agilon Health reported Q2 2026 revenue of $1.495B (+7% YoY), with net income of $18M vs. loss of $104M YoY. The company raised full-year 2026 guidance: total revenues to $5.775B–$5.860B (prior $5.680B–$5.805B), medical margin to $465M–$505M (prior $350M–$400M), and adjusted EBITDA to $75M–$95M (prior $10M–$40M). Platform membership declined to 549K members (437K Medicare Advantage, 112K ACO) due to disciplined contracting; however, burden-of-illness outperformance and favorable medical cost trends drove the improved outlook. Balance sheet: $257M cash, $32M debt.
Why this rating

Significant operational turnaround and upside revision. Adjusted EBITDA guidance more than doubled. Revenue and medical margin upgrades material relative to $709M market cap; profitability inflection credible but membership decline risk; Q3 guidance shows deceleration.
